A1: TEFL (Teaching English as a Foreign Language) concentrates on mentor English to non-native speakers in countries where English is not the main language. TESOL (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ages) is a more comprehensive term that incorporates both TEFL and TESL (Teaching English as a Second Language), which is focused on teaching English in nations where it is spoken.
